Axial-to-Central Chirality Transfer for Construction of Quaternary Stereocenters via Dearomatization of BINOLs

All-carbon quaternary stereocenters are versatile building blocks, and their asymmetric construction has attracted much attention. Herein, we disclose an axial-to-central chirality transfer strategy for the synthesis of chiral quaternary stereocenters via dearomatization of (S)-BINOLs. The reaction proceeded smoothly with a wide range of propargyl carbonates to afford chiral spiro-compounds in high yields with excellent enantioselectivities. In addition, the strategy was extended to kinetic resolution of rac-BINOLs albeit with moderate s value.
Synthesis of β-Trifluoromethylated Ketones from Propargylic Alcohols by Visible Light Photoredox Catalysis

Regioselective trifluoromethylation at a remote position represents an important challenge in the development of biologically active molecules and functional materials. A practical method to access β-trifluoromethyl ketones from readily available propargylic alcohols by visible light photocatalysis has been developed. Trifluoromethylation of propargylic alcohols with CF3I in the presence of Ru(bpy)3Cl2 as the photocatalyst followed by double-bond migration/keto-enol tautomerization provides β-trifluoromethyl ketones as the final product. β-Trifluoromethyl ketones are synthesized from readily available propargylic alcohols by visible light photocatalysis. Trifluoromethylation followed by double-bond migration/keto-enol tautomerization provides β-trifluoromethyl ketones as the final product.
Rapid preparation of 3-deoxyanthocyanidins and novel dicationic derivatives: New insight into an old procedure

Common 3-deoxyanthocyanidins and original dicationic flavylium- benzopyrylium derivatives are easily and efficiently synthesized through reactions between the corresponding phenols and aryl ethynyl ketones in the presence of aqueous hexafluorophosphoric acid. The mechanism of the reaction is discussed and two competitive pathways are consistent with our results. Wiley-VCH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, 2007.
Straightforward synthesis of highly hydroxylated phloroglucinol-type 3-deoxyanthocyanidins

Phloroglucinol-type 3-deoxyanthocyanidins were synthesized through the interaction between phloroglucinol derivatives and arylethynylketones in acetic acid in the presence of aqueous hexafluorophosphoric acid. This methodology was applied to achieve the synthesis of natural apigeninidin, luteolinidin and tricetanidin with high yields. Georg Thieme Verlag Stuttgart.
